The Post-Red Cliff Fu is an essay written by Su Shi, a writer in the Northern Song Dynasty, when he relegated Huangzhou, and it is a sequel to the Former Red Cliff Fu. The former fu describes the night scene on the river in early autumn, while the latter fu describes the activities along the Mengdong River, both of which are the scenery of Chibi, but the realm is quite different. The former fu is "the wind coming from Xu, the water waves are stagnant" and "the dew crosses the river, and the water meets the sky", and the latter fu is "the river flows, the thousands of feet breaks, the mountains are high and the moon is small, and the water comes out". The landscape features of different seasons are vividly reflected in Su Shi's works, giving people magnificent and natural beauty enjoyment.

There are three levels in Houchibi Fu. The first level is about the night tour in Huangniban, the moonlight in early winter and the joy of stepping on the moon, paving the way for the trip to Chibi. The second level describes the scenery and process of revisiting Chibi, lamenting that "the geometry of the sun and the moon was once unknown", expressing all kinds of depressed meanings accumulated in the heart since the relegation of Huangzhou, alluding to the sinister political environment at that time. In the third pass, a Taoist priest fell asleep after swimming and dreamed that he had become a lonely crane. This mysterious dream reveals the author's inner pain. Su Shi, who is politically frustrated, wants to seek detachment from the joy of mountains and rivers. The result was not only useless, but also added new pain to the trauma in his heart.
